Routes for Vehicles Transporting Explosives. The routes referred to in the Mt1€G <br />MSFC for vehicles transporting explosives and blasting agents, are hereby established as <br />follows: <br />(a) Hennepin County Highway 88 <br />(b) County Road C, east of Hennepin County Highway 88 <br />(c) Anthony Lane. <br />Subd. 3. Routes for Vehicles Transporting Hazardous Chemicals. Motor vehicle routes for <br />vehicles transporting hazardous chemicals or dangerous articles, as described in the Mt I€C <br />MSFC, are hereby established as follows: <br />(a) Hennepin County Highway 88 <br />(b) County Road C, east of Hennepin County Highway 88 <br />(c) Anthony Lane. <br />1325.06 Fire Lanes. <br />Subd. 1. Orders Establishing. The Fire Marshal may order the establishment of fire lanes on public or <br />private property as may be necessary for travel of fire or emerpencv equipment and access to fire <br />hydrants protection devices or buildings. If there is a curb in the fire lane, it must be painted <br />yellow. The Fire Marshal may require the fire lane to be outlined in yellow on the pavement. When the <br />fire lane is on public property or a public right -of -way, the sign or signs will be erected by the City. <br />When the fire lane is on private property, the sign or signs will be erected by the owner at the owner's <br />expense as directed by the Fire Chief. The signs must be erected within 30 days after notice of the <br />order. <br />Subd. 2. Obstruction; Impoundment. No person may leave a vehicle or other object unattended or <br />otherwise occupy or obstruct a fire lane. No vehicle impounded pursuant to the provisions of this <br />Section may be released until a release is obtained from the Police Department and all towing and <br />storing charges have been paid. <br />Page 11 of 18 <br />
